Peace Talks Collapse While Trump Hits UFC Night

Peace Talks Collapse While Trump Hits UFC Night

High-stakes US–Iran negotiations in Pakistan collapsed after 21 hours, with both sides blaming each other over nuclear demands and control of the Strait of Hormuz. The fragile ceasefire now hangs in the balance. Meanwhile, Donald Trump attended a UFC fight during the talks, downplaying the failure and insisting the US “wins either way,” even as tensions risk escalating again.
